Provide Comprehensive and Relevant Information

A well-designed investor centre should be a one-stop-shop for all the information investors need to make informed decisions. Ensure that you provide comprehensive and up-to-date information about your company's financials, key performance indicators, corporate governance, and investor presentations. Consider including an archive of past investor communications, such as annual reports, earnings releases, and transcripts of investor conference calls. By providing a wide range of relevant information, you demonstrate transparency and build trust with your investors.

Utilize Multimedia Elements

Incorporating multimedia elements into your investor centre content can significantly enhance its effectiveness. Consider adding videos of executive interviews, product demonstrations, or virtual tours of your facilities. Videos are a powerful tool for conveying your company's story and culture. Additionally, consider adding audio recordings of investor conference calls or podcasts where you discuss key developments and strategies. By leveraging multimedia, you can create a more dynamic and engaging experience for investors.
